Address

KUmiXhr2VroLD2pDtCF4cLy3MX94mbgRfe

0 KUMA

Confirmed
Total Received17.61332700 KUMA
Total Sent17.61332700 KUMA
Final Balance0 KUMA
No. Transactions2

Transactions

KUmiXhr2VroLD2pDtCF4cLy3MX94mbgRfe17.61332700 KUMA
 
 
KUmiXhr2VroLD2pDtCF4cLy3MX94mbgRfe17.61332700 KUMA